So far:
*Manifold is super compact
*The turbo (with 1.06 turbine housing) and associated pipework all fits in beautifully
*I have way more room than with previous setup
*Heat management should be a breeze
*Good flow paths for all associated pipework
*Have retained the 38mm wastegate ....this is quite small comparatively, but it worked great in previous setup and my flow path to it is almost as good so ...fingers xd
*It had better work because I've modified too many parts to turn back now
*No issues
*Boost control is perfect ... am able to hold 6psi spring pressure all the way to redline (no creep at all). Makes 280whp at only 6psi
*Small gain in low range which I think is more to do with improved siamese flow pre opening of WG (old setup used siamese solely for WG duties , new one doesn't)
*Stock ground clearance . was able to reuse stock crossmember
*spoolup is the same (still good but no improvement)
*Power is the same up top (still good but no improvement)
*Exhaust tone has changed markedly once WG opens ...nice aggressive tone but a little quieter.
Overall ....pretty happy with result even though the major goal was not achieved.
Still have something up my sleeve that I can try now that I know boost control isn't an issue.
